Part-time jobs in Carroll County, MD, are available in a wide range of industries, including retail, hospitality, healthcare, education, and more. Some of the most popular part-time jobs in Carroll County include: 1. Retail Sales Associate Retail sales associates work in stores and help customers find products they need. This job requires good communication skills, a friendly attitude,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ment. Retail sales associates typically work part-time and earn an hourly wage. 2. Food Service Worker Food service workers work in restaurants, cafes, and other food establishments. They prepare food, take orders, and serve customers. This job requires good communication skills and the ability to work under pressure. Food service workers typically work part-time and earn an hourly wage. 3. Customer Service Representative Customer service representatives work in call centers, answering questions and resolving issues for customers. This job requires good communication skills, problem-solving skills,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ment. Customer service representatives typically work part-time and earn an hourly wage. 4. Tutor Tutors work with students to help them improve their academic performance. This job requires good communication skills, a strong knowledge of the subject matter, and the ability to work one-on-one with students. Tutors typically work part-time and earn an hourly wage. 5. Housekeeper Housekeepers work in hotels, resorts, and private homes, cleaning and maintaining the living spaces. This job requires good attention to detail, physical stamina, and the ability to work independently. Housekeepers typically work part-time and earn an hourly wage. 6. Personal Care Aide Personal care aides work in healthcare facilities, providing assistance to patients with daily tasks like bathing, dressing, and eating. This job requires good communication skills, compassion,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ment. Personal care aides typically work part-time and earn an hourly wage. 7. Substitute Teacher Substitute teachers work in schools, filling in for regular teachers who are absent. This job requires good communication skills, a strong knowledge of the subject matter, and the ability to work with students of all ages. Substitute teachers typically work part-time and earn an hourly wage. 8. Event Staff Event staff work at concerts, sporting events, and other large gatherings, helping with set-up, tear-down, and customer service. This job requires good communication skills, physical stamina,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ment. Event staff typically work part-time and earn an hourly wage. 9. Delivery Driver Delivery drivers work for restaurants, stores, and other businesses, delivering products to customers. This job requires good communication skills, a valid driver's license, and the ability to work independently. Delivery drivers typically work part-time and earn an hourly wage plus tips. 10. Dog Walker/Pet Sitter Dog walkers and pet sitters work for pet owners, taking care of their animals while they are away. This job requires good communication skills, a love of animals, and the ability to work independently. Dog walkers and pet sitters typically work part-time and earn an hourly wage. The History of Nestle in Anderson, Indiana Nestle has been a part of the Anderson, Indiana, community for over 100 years. The company first established a presence in Anderson in 1901, and since then, the company has grown significantly. Today, Nestle has several manufacturing facilities in Anderson, Indiana, that produce a wide range of food and beverage products. Nestle's impact on the local economy has been significant. The company employs over 1,000 people in Anderson, Indiana, and it is one of the largest employers in the region. Nestle has also been a significant contributor to the local community, supporting various community initiatives and charitable organizations. Why Work at Nestle in Anderson, Indiana?
